I am still doing this old school. Every week I select 1 to 3 cookbooks and use coloured sticky tabs to mark which recipes I will do for the next 7 days.

Once a recipe is made, the sticky tab goes away (mostly to the front of the book on the first page ready to be re-used) and then I add a small coloured sticky dot in the bottom corner of the page.

Green = enjoyed the recipe, would happily cook again Orange = ok but not worth cooking again unless modified Red = do not bother with this recipe again

So when I go through a book I haven't use in ages at least I can quickly see which recipes haven't been done and which ones were winners.
